Most people know when they need to see a doctor for a physical ailment. But many don't know when the help of a psychologist might make a difference. Could you be one of these people?
Take action:
Some of the signs that you may need help include: you're more emotional, i.e. more down or much happier (almost elated), than usual; you're more anxious or tense than normal; your sleep patterns are disturbed – you need to sleep more or you're unable to fall or stay asleep; you eat more or less than usual; you're abusing substances; you experience physical problems, e.g. heart palpitations, unusual sweating, or trembling; you have difficulty concentrating or remembering; your school or work performance isn't what it used to be; or you feel that you're not coping with everyday tasks.
